Sale of Hazardous Goods (Children's Dart Gun Sets and Yo-Yo Water Balls) Order 2003

The Products Safety Committee makes the following order under section 8 of the Sale of Hazardous Goods Act 1977 .

1.   Short title

This order may be cited as the Sale of Hazardous Goods (Children's Dart Gun Sets and Yo-Yo Water Balls) Order 2003 .

2.   Commencement

This order takes effect on the day on which its making is notified in the Gazette.

3.   Interpretation

In this order –
children's dart gun set means a children's dart gun set, with or without a target, consisting of –
(a) a firing gun; and
(b) suction-tipped darts that fit entirely into the small parts test cylinder when tested in accordance with clause 5.2 (small parts test) of the Australian/New Zealand Standard Safety of Toys, Part 1 (AS/NZS ISO 8124.1:2002);
yo-yo water ball means a ball or other shape, attached to a stretchable cord capable of extending to at least 500 millimetres in length, that is squeezable, soft, synthetic and liquid-filled.

4.   Prohibition on sale of children's dart gun sets

A person must not sell a children's dart gun set.

5.   Prohibition on sale of yo-yo water balls

A person must not sell a yo-yo water ball.

EXPLANATORY NOTE

(This note is not part of the rule)

This order prohibits the sale of –
(a) yo-yo water balls; and
(b) children's dart gun sets.
